Orioles sign Brian Matusz to one-year, $3.9 million deal

BALTIMORE -- The Orioles have reached agreement with left-hander Brian Matusz on a $3.9 million, one-year contract, avoiding arbitration.

Matusz, 28, went 1-4 with a 2.94 ERA in 58 appearances out of the bullpen last season for Baltimore. He struck out 59 over 49 innings.

Matusz, who made $3.2 million last year, has a career record of 27-41 with a 4.76 ERA in seven seasons.

Matusz asked for $4.4 million, and the Orioles offered $3.5 million, leaving Thursday's agreement $50,000 below the midpoint.

Closer Zach Britton is the Orioles' only remaining player in arbitration.
